Timberlake, Ohio, in Lake county, is 5 miles W of Mentor, Ohio (center to center) and 17 miles NE of Cleveland, Ohio. The village contains a population of approximately 775.
In Timberlake, about 63% of adults are married. Married couples seem to be the rule in Timberlake, at least compared to other villages of its size.
In 2000, Timberlake had a median family income of $57,604. The typical family in Timberlake is better off than most in Ohio. The village has a large middle class. There just aren't a lot of poor people in Timberlake. Interestingly, lots of people in the village have Bachelor's degrees (or better). In Timberlake, there is a large number of singles who make a good living.
Timberlake has, of course, a mix of various types of housing. Recently 94% of the livable housing units were owner-occupied. Taxes on residences are higher here than most places in Ohio, which may reflect a commitment to education in the village.
In Timberlake, 93% of commuters drive to work.
